Uber and Lyft drivers prompted to get business licenses
$91 licenses to generate $3.37 million annual city revenue
In San Francisco, drivers of popular Uber and Lyft crowdsourced transportation services will now be required to obtain their own business licenses to operate within the city, according to a letter from the Office of the Treasurer and Tax Collector mailed out to drivers on Friday.
